Legacy of Love Benefit and Fashion Show!

Last week on April 16th, The Women’s Auxilary to Children’s Medical Center partnered up with Park Place Lexus and TOOTSIES to host the second annual Legacy of Love Benefit and Fashion show. We were so honored to produce and direct the fashion show. There was several local fashion icons such as Courtney Kerr of What Courtney Wore; Lauren Scruggs of LOLO Magazine; and Shannon Yoachum of Style by Lolly.

We want to give a special thanks to Lisa Raskin. Lisa thank you so much for going above and beyond for this event and being such hard worker! Finally, we are excited to announce the event raised over $130,000 and all of the proceeds will benefit the Children's Medical Center! 

Children’s Medical Center Dallas has been upholding its mission of making life better for children for more than 100 years. In 2008, the hospital opened Children’s at Legacy in Plano in order to better serve the region's growing pediatric population. Soon after opening the Legacy campus, the Women’s Auxiliary to Children’s Medical Center, Legacy Chapter, was formed to serve as a fundraising arm for the hospital. The net proceeds from the Legacy of Love Benefit and Fashion Show will go directly to Children’s.

Pat Smith's "Second Chances for Overcomer's"

Last week, I was blessed and honored to be a part of Pat Smith’s “Second Chances for Overcomer's” at the Dallas Hyatt Regency. RSC Show Productions, LLC  was part of the production team and was one of the event coordinators! We hit the ground running starting at 4:30 AM that day and stayed BUSY until the end. I was so excited that the little sleep I had energized me as if I had a full 8 hours of rest!

Now let’s talk about the actual event! There were so many inspirational stories shared during this event, and my favorite part about the event was being able to feel God's presence speaking through the gifted people he placed before us that day. Pat Smith was so genuine and sincere, she was our voice of honesty. Pat Smith is the most gracious spirit and her life mission is to help others. She created this event to help women find a renewed sense of power and purpose. In putting this event together, she brought together women all over Dallas and the country who have experienced and overcome adversity so that they could share their unique and moving experiences. The speakers included:

Cindi Broaddus – Dr. Phil's sister-in-law who was transformed by tragedy when an unknown assailant threw a gallon–sized jar full of sulphuric acid off an overpass and through the windshield of her car.Wendy Davis – Texas gubernatorial candidate who began working at the age of 14 to support her family, and as a teenage mother, became the first in her family to attend college, eventually graduating from Harvard Law School.Sybrina Fulton - Mother of slain teenager Trayvon Martin who has become an advocate for families of crime victims, raising awareness about racial and gender profiling and educating youth on conflict resolution techniques to reduce deadly confrontations.Sarah Jakes – Daughter of The Potter’s House Bishop T.D. Jakes who has shared her own deep personal setbacks, including teenage pregnancy and divorce, to help women transform their circumstances.Antoinette Tuff – Atlanta school bookkeeper whose heroism and compassion prevented a mass school shootingimage002

The amazing keynote speaker was Robin Roberts from Good Morning America. We all have watched Robin battle cancer on more than one occasion and she overcome it beautifully. I have to share how beautiful Robin Roberts is on the inside as well as the outside. She shared her struggles, moments of weakness, and how she fought to live. She shared how she got through it all and gave everyone in the room, including me, more strength. "It's not what you achieve, it's what you overcome."

Baylor Celebrating Women!

Since 2008, I have been honored to be the Production Coordinator for the Baylor Health Care System's Celebrating Women Event. The event was held at the Hilton Anatole in Dallas on October 23rd. This year was truly  memorable because we raised over $2 million dollars to help the fight against breast cancer. This year’s keynote speaker was former #NFL player Chris Spielman, who lost his wife to breast cancer in 2009. He spoke about his struggles and explained how he continues to promote increasing awareness about the disease. He aims to share his experience and carry on his wife’s legacy, hoping they will find a cure.

Did you know  someone is diagnosed with breast cancer every 4 hours, just in the DFW area? Baylor Health Care System created Celebrating Women back in 2000 because they treat breast  cancer more than any other type of cancer! All of the funds from Celebrating Women have contributed to four main areas: capital & technology, medical education, patient center programs, and above all, research. The Elisa Project ESTEEM Fashion Show

2013 ESTEEM Fashion Show was a huge success! Many thanks to Tootsies and all of our sponsors for their continued support! As the producer and founder of ESTEEM, I could not have been more proud.

The ESTEEM Fashion Show was created to help promote a positive body image and healthy self esteem. After modeling since I was 15 years old, I see how unfortunate it is that the modeling industry is stereotyped by eating disorders. The reality is this disease can affect anyone. After losing a college friend to the disease, I was inspired to launch an event that encourages women, girls, men and boys to love their bodies and understand that the “front-cover look” is not necessarily representative of a healthy or “perfect” body. Through this event, my aim has two meanings. Not only to increase awareness about eating disorders but also to help those who may have an eating disorder. It is through this increased awareness that we can empower others to recognize the signs and symptoms in friends or family to help prevent losses like that of my friend years ago.

The ESTEEM Fashion show was held at TOOTSIES in Dallas on Saturday, September 21, 2013 at 10:30 AM. With Debbie Denmon as our Mistress of Ceremonies, we had a sold out crowd of over 200 guests that stay to shop, keeping the cash registers hot for hours following the fashion show!
